Understanding Traffic Patterns and Timing

Mastering the art of the chicken road demands more than just quick reflexes. Observing the patterns of oncoming traffic is crucial. Notice that vehicles rarely appear simultaneously in all lanes; there’s often a rhythm, a brief window of opportunity between waves of cars. Experienced players meticulously analyze these gaps, waiting for the perfect moment to initiate a crossing. This isn't about sprinting across as quickly as possible; it's about timing your movements to exploit the natural lulls in traffic flow. Furthermore, different game variations introduce speed variations among the vehicles, adding another layer of complexity to the challenge. The speed of the vehicles requires a constant re-evaluation of the perceived safety windows.

Utilizing Sound Cues for Enhanced Awareness

Many versions of the game provide auditory cues that can significantly enhance a player’s awareness. The sound of an approaching vehicle, the honking of a horn, or even subtle changes in the background music can all serve as warnings. Rather than relying solely on visual observation, skilled players learn to integrate these audio cues into their decision-making process. This multi-sensory approach allows for quicker reactions and more informed judgments, giving them a crucial edge in avoiding collisions. Ignoring these sound cues is a common mistake among novice players, frequently leading to an early demise for their courageous chicken.

Advanced Techniques for Lane Mastery

Beyond the fundamentals, experienced players employ a number of advanced techniques to maximize their score. One such technique is the “short hop,” a quick dash across one or two lanes during brief pauses in traffic. This allows players to build up their lane count gradually, minimizing the risk of a catastrophic collision. Another technique involves carefully timing your cross with the movement of larger vehicles, using them as temporary shields against faster traffic. However, this requires precise timing and a thorough understanding of vehicle speeds. It is a high-risk, high-reward maneuver that can dramatically increase your score if executed correctly. The positioning of the chicken itself can also influence survival.

Exploiting Vehicle Behavior & Spawning

Observing the vehicle spawning patterns is also critical. Some games exhibit a tendency to spawn vehicles in clusters after periods of relative calm. Anticipating these patterns allows players to prepare for increased traffic density and adjust their strategy accordingly. Additionally, certain vehicles may exhibit predictable behaviors, such as consistently swerving slightly to the left or right. Recognizing these tendencies allows players to exploit them, creating additional opportunities for safe crossings. Understanding these nuances can be the difference between a successful run and a quick defeat. The ability to adapt to the game's specific quirks is a hallmark of a skilled player.
